Swift Change Button Color When Pressed, We can do this in two ways,


Swift Change Button Color When Pressed, We can do this in two ways, programmatically and using the storyboard. I've been looking things up for a while but th Mar 10, 2022 · I want to change foreground and background colors of selected buttons but when I click on one button it select all buttons and change their colors too. Toggle button color change on press class _MyHomePageState extends State<MyHomePage> { // 1 bool _hasBeenPressed = false; @override Widget build (BuildContext context) May 1, 2024 · Learn how to use a SwiftUI Button to handle user interaction. Jun 26, 2014 · I am new to the swift language. In this article, we'll explore how to change the button color when pressed in SwiftUI, explaining the process step-by-step with easy-to-understand examples that anyone can follow. macOS Tahoe with a new design, more ways to work seamlessly across devices, and new features to turbocharge productivity every day. I'm very new to iOS and Swift. So it starts white, after pressing it, it will change to either green or red. Find tickets to your next unforgettable experience. This is my whole CustomButton view struct: struct CustomButton: View { @State private var didTap:Bool = false var body: some View { Get full-length product reviews, the latest news, tech coverage, daily deals, and category deep dives from CNET experts worldwide. I also need to change the state to Disabled after the user presses it. I have tried this: @ May 4, 2023 · You can use a simple String or a more complex Label view, where the Label view can display both text and an icon. Apr 20, 2024 · To change the color of a button in Swift when it is pressed and released, you can use the `UIButton` class and its various states such as `highlighted` and `normal`. I have searched this on google and see many posts about this. Before this, you should have already set up an IBOutlet for the button. Feb 5, 2023 · Creating buttons in SwiftUI can be quite straightforward in iOS 15. the button is gray, an To change the background color of a button in iOS application we need to access the property ‘ backgroundColor’ of the UIButton. Method 1 − Using the storyboard editor Add a button on your storyboard, select it Go to it’s attribute inspector and select 'Background' property to choose the color. foregroundColor on our text view. Set the foreground/font color to white . When the user taps on the button, it becomes transparent. On iOS 13, however, this is Dec 15, 2020 · 1 I'm trying to create a Quiz app that consists of two buttons, false and true button. com") print (" Nov 19, 2021 · Hola Mundo! Allow me to start with a little bit of context, I'm new at Swiftone Dec 17, 2024 · Add interaction to your app with a SwiftUI Button, custom styles, and interactions. I have no idea how to do this. Feb 16, 2023 · Learn how to customize SwiftUI Button appearance and interaction using ButtonStyle & PrimitiveButtonStyle protocols. For example, we could create a second style that makes the button grow when it’s being pressed down: Learn how to temporarily change the background color of UIButton in Swift when pressed, perfect for your quiz app! ---more The isTapped state variable toggles between true and false when the button is pressed. Sep 24, 2024 · Let's delve into the intricacies of styling SwiftUI Buttons, exploring advanced techniques to craft visually appealing and user-friendly interfaces. Sep 5, 2019 · I am trying to change colour of my Button in SwiftUI. Apr 16, 2021 · 1 hello I currently have an app that flashes a random color when the button is pressed but it gets stuck in a loop and I can't change to other colors when I press the button again. Add custom animations & control button behavior. Oct 27, 2022 · Changing text when button is pressed Forums > SwiftUI SPONSORED Reduce churn at the moment it matters most. You can also use an Image view as a button label to display a custom icon or image. Feb 15, 2020 · To change a button's text color in SwiftUI we need to use . thank you so much !!! sets the background and text color of the button. I want to change a button's color base on the value returned after I press it. This tutorial contains sample code and common use cases for button styles and various button types. Jun 19, 2019 · I have a textfield with a send button that's a systemImage arrow. I am going to replace the previous body variable with the following: For example, a destructive button in a contextual menu appears with a red foreground color: If you don’t specify a role for a button, the system applies an appropriate default appearance. Jul 13, 2015 · You'll start off by first actually setting up the button's background colour in the ViewDidLoad () method. Learn how you can define reusable components. white) // 3. Jun 28, 2020 · I want to change the view when I press the button in SwiftUI. Sep 7, 2020 · In this tutorial I will show you how you can change the color of a button when a user presses it. However the solutions are not what I'm looking for. Browse concerts, workshops, yoga classes, charity events, food and music festivals, and more things to do. font (. The simple, quick and secure way to send your files around the world without an account. Use 'primary' for main call-to-action buttons, 'secondary' for a more subdued style, 'stop' for a stop button, 'huggingface' for a black background with white text, consistent with Hugging Face's button styles. . This helps to user to understand that the button was pressed and something should happen. What I want to do is to change the buttons background color and keep the image as white while the button is pushed down. I want the foreground color of the image to change depending on whether the textField is empty or not. To demonstrate this I will be using a RaisedButton. ZStack { Button (action: { Settings (logOutAfter24H: true, emailAddress: "example@example. You just need to add the following code to have a purple button that changes its color once pressed. My question is, when I press one of the two buttons, I want it to change its background colour ONLY SHORTLY when its pressed then I want it to go back to the color it originally was, but I can not figure out how to change the background color shortly. title) // 4. Aug 6, 2019 · Change the background color to purple including the padding . I would also like to have the message disappear when the button is pressed. I have a grid filled with buttons (3x3 for now). Apple has announced an upcoming Retention Messaging API that will allow apps to show personalized messages and offers directly in the iOS subscription cancellation flow. foregroundColor (. (I. The background color changes dynamically between green and red based on the value of isTapped. e. Can someone tell me how to change the background color of a button using the swift language? Aug 6, 2014 · I need to change the color of my button's text. Share your files, photos, and videos today for free. Jun 16, 2023 · The button configuration we’re passed includes whether the button is currently being pressed or not, so we can us that to adjust our button. I've found solution with ID but it works with custom button ios - SwiftUI - How to change the colour of all other buttons when pressing on button? I have a UIButton that has a white image of an arrow. xrrwgm, hjenv, q3ua9, rslw, q0q8, x6vp, t5hop, h4kcuq, ekajl, ykbc,